/* --- Active sidebar item = brand blue ----------------------------------- */
:root { --brand:#2D83B0; }

/* Highlight the active link, text & icon */
.fi-sidebar a[aria-current="page"],
.fi-sidebar .fi-sidebar-item.fi-active > a,
.fi-sidebar .fi-sidebar-item[data-active="true"] > a {
  color: var(--brand) !important;
  background: color-mix(in srgb, var(--brand) 12%, transparent);
}

.fi-sidebar a[aria-current="page"] .fi-icon,
.fi-sidebar .fi-sidebar-item.fi-active > a .fi-icon {
  color: var(--brand) !important;
}

/* Left indicator bar (when present) */
.fi-sidebar .fi-sidebar-item-indicator,
.fi-sidebar .fi-sidebar-item::before {
  background-color: var(--brand) !important;
}

/* Primary buttons = brand blue + WHITE text (used below for PDF) */
.fi-btn.fi-color-primary{
  background-color: var(--brand) !important;
  border-color: var(--brand) !important;
  color:#fff !important;
}
.fi-btn.fi-color-primary:hover{ filter:brightness(0.95); }
